[Moderators note: This post is to provide an example of Open Season availability during the summer travel season]

Open Season Availability for the next 30 days (June 16 thru July 15)

Open Season Nightly Rates (excluding tax): Mid-Week(Sun-Thu) / Weekend (Fri-Sat)
Studio/Studio Plus $60 / $80
One Bedroom $80 / $100
One Bedroom Plus $100 / $120
One Bedroom Premier $140 / $160
Two Bedroom $100 / $120
Two Bedroom Plus $120 / $140
Two Bedroom Premier $140 / $160
Three Bedroom $130 / $150
Three Bedroom Plus $190 / $210
Two Bedroom Penthouse $240 / $260
Three Bedroom Penthouse $290 / $310

NOTE: 2-night minimum stay required; Open season rental reservations are available to members only

How do I get to the 'sighting boards"??

Sorry, I just realized that I only explained how to get to the TUG sighting board.

If you're planning to use RCI or Interval International (II) heavily, I suggest joining TS4MS (http://www.timeshareforums.com/) to gain access to their sighting forum (called Exchange Opps). It is invaluable if you plan to exchange on a regular basis. The TUG sighting board is ok but TS4MS sighting board has more coverage. Also by using the search function you can obtain historical sighting information to help determine any exchange availability patterns.

Sightings are also helpful in alerting folks to exchange opportunities based on bulk spacebanking (see definition below). You'll want to place a request for an exchange before or soon after a bulk spacebanking is sighted. But keep in mind that sightings are an online snapshot of weeks leftover after ongoing search requests have been satisfied. As soon as a sighting is posted, folks will attempt to reserve one. Depending on the demand of the resort and/or weeks, availability can disappear within minutes, hours, days or months.

You can gain access to TS4MS sightings by joining TS4MS and posting at least 30 times on the TS4MS forum OR by becoming a TS4MS bronze contributor which gives you access to all forums for only $12. It's definitely worth the $12 - see http://www.timeshareforums.com/foru...ill-now-need-30-posts-view-exchange-opps.html

For more basic info on exchanging see this old post - http://tugbbs.com/forums/showpost.php?p=717473&postcount=9

From a TUG Advice board article - http://www.tug2.net/advice/TimeShare-101.htm
Bulk spacebanking is a practice in which a resort periodically deposits a large number of unassigned units with the exchange company in advance of when the owners actually decide to deposit their weeks. If your resort bulk spacebanks, you contact your resort to let them know that you intend to use your week for an exchange through the affiliated exchange company. The resort then contacts the exchange company and arranges for one of their bulk spacebanked weeks to be transferred to your account.
